# Download & Install

## Download the Plugin

1. Visit this page on GitHub: <https://github.com/TheThunderLizard/bronto_woocommerce>
2. Click **Clone or Download** &#x20;

   <img src="/files/-LesEb8cjJHRqGA6avF9" alt="" data-size="original">
3. Next, login in to your WooCommerce site and click **Plugins** » **Add New** <img src="/files/-LesHGdRoNwqbX1UOIxX" alt="" data-size="original">&#x20;
4. Next, select **Upload Plugin** &#x20;

   <img src="/files/-LesHfmiJ_7aTvH7vpXr" alt="" data-size="original">
5. Then in the dialogue that displays, click **Choose File** and find the .zip file you downloaded from step 1.   Then click **Install Now**. &#x20;

   <img src="/files/-LesIACoubJzIY5OcV9Z" alt="" data-size="original">
6. After the install runs, click **Activate Plugin**

   <img src="/files/-LesIYW9tXdfNb5vNGYK" alt="" data-size="original">
7. Your install is complete.
